Old Silk Road, a New Tourist Favor
In the first four months of 1999, the Old Silk Road received nealy 7,000 overseas tourists,and foreign exchange earnings increased 20 percent over the same period of last year. The Old Silk Road is becoming a favorite route of international tourists.
A series of classic tours have been developed, including the Hexi Corridor Silk Road Desert Landscape Tour, Gansu Eastward Silk Road Root Seekking and Pilgrimage Tour, Gansu Southward Hui-Tibetan Folklore and Grassland Tour, Qilian Mountain Mountaineering and Adventure Tour, Silk Road Grotto Art Study Tour, and Desert Expedition Tour.
Besides organized group tours, a large number of individual tourists have also come to visit the Old Silk Road. The annual French Old Silk long-distance race group visited the Old Silk Road for the fourth time this year. This year, some Norwegians will organize bicycle tour groups.
Tibet Develops Special-Interest Tours
Tibet has developed five tourists areas, each with its own special characteristics.
The five tourist area are: the cultural appreciation tourist area centered on Lhasa, the Eastern Tibet adventure tourist area,mainly featuring mountian climbing; the Southeast Tibet scientific investigation; the cultural tourist area, mainly featuring wildlife.
To promote Tibet's travel industry, the autonomous region invested 4 billion yuan last year in strengthening infrastructure facilities. As a result, Tibet's transportation and telecommunications have greatly improved. At prenst, Tibet is accelerating the renovation of the Sichuan-Tibet, Yunnan-Tibet and Xijiang-Tibet highways, and is working hard to guarantee the smooth operation of trunk highways from Lhasa optical-fiber cabke and the Lhaso telecommunications pivotal project have entered the completion stage.
International Goodwill Months to Be Held
The International Goodwill Months will be held in Shenyang, capital of Liaoning Province, from August to October in northeast China.
The International Goodwill Months will involve different fields such as trade, tourism, culture, sports, agriculture and industry. 17 main activities will be arranged. They are:
August: The sixth China Drama Festival
September: China International Wine Culture Festival, Shenyang International Auto Industrial Exposition,International Flowers Exhibition and TRade Fair, International Economic and Trade Fair, International Music Festival,and International Super Model Contest China District Selective Trial.
October: The eighth China Golden Rooster and Hundred Flowers Film Festival, the World Chess and Card Playing Competition.
The other main activities include the International Agricultural Exposition, the Cosmetic and Hairdressers' Articles Exposition, Shenyang Commodities Fair, International Beer Festival, China Northeast Vegetables Festival, World Famous Dogs Exhibition, International Seminar on Environmental Strategy, and China Northeast International Power Technical Equipment Exhibition.
Hengshan Culture and Tourism Festival to Kick Off
The '99 China Mount Hengshan Culture and Tourism Festival will be held in Hunyuan County, Shanxi Province from August 8 to 28.
During the festival a number of activities will be arranged, including the exhibition of paintings, calligraphy and photography, the International Year of Older Persons Mountaineering Competition, the Annual Meeting of the Five Mountains, and the Datong Tourism Investment Soliciting Fair.
Mount Hengshan was designated as a national key scenic and historical area by the State Council in 1982,and is a sacred place for Taosim and heritage tour.
Temple Fair on Jiuhua Mountain
The 17th Temple Fair on Jiuhua Mountain will be held from August 16 to September 16 on Jiuhua Mountain, a key scenic area in China and one of China's four scared Buddhist mountains.
During the temple fair grand Buddhist ceremonies and folklore activities will be held. The entertainment includes a Buddhist music concert, Nuo dances, Nuo operas, dragon lantern dances and Weifeng drums and gongs.
More than 1,000 guests and monks will travel from Singapore, Malaysia, Australia, Taiwan and Hong Kong to attend the fair.
Shishi Sea World
Shishi City in Fujian Province has finished constructing China's inland largest sea theme paradise-Shishi sea World.
Built at cost of 500 million yuan,it is located in the Golden Beach Holiday Village in southern Fujian. The world consists of the submarine hall, dolphin performance hall, marine scientific and technological hall, diving hall and underwater performance hall, in addition to the subsidiary halls of rocks in fantastic shapes and root art carvings. The auxiliary projects including hotels, restaurants, tea houses by the sea and shopping facilities have been completed in the sea world.
